Description:
Gustaf Börtner, oil on canvas, listed Swedish artist.Colourful modernist landscape with stylised tree forms and architectural elements, executed in a free and expressive brushwork. Signed and dated 1945.
Origin: Sweden.
Material: Oil on canvas.
Dimensions: Visual size 49 × 60 cm, total size 71 × 82 cm.
Period: 1945.
Condition: Excellent condition with minor signs of wear.
Bio:
Gustaf Börtner (1905–1985) was a Swedish painter associated with modernism. He studied in Copenhagen under Folmer Bonnén and later in Stockholm with Isaac Grünewald, a key figure in introducing French modernism to Scandinavia. Börtner worked with landscapes, coastal scenes and forest interiors, often characterised by strong colours and an expressive visual language. In his early career he signed works as “Zandt” or “Andersson-Zandt” before adopting the name Börtner in the late 1940s. His works are represented in collections such as Bollnäs Museum and Kristianstad Museum.
